What Does Biodegradable Mean?

Before we delve into whether cat litter is biodegradable, let's clarify what "biodegradable" means. Biodegradable materials are those that can break down naturally through the action of living organisms, usually within a reasonable time frame. This means that they are less likely to contribute to long-term environmental pollution compared to their non-biodegradable counterparts.

Types of Cat Litter

To answer the question of whether cat litter is biodegradable, it’s crucial to examine the different types of cat litter available on the market:

1. Clay-Based Litter

  • Bentonite Clay: The most common type, typically considered non-biodegradable. Although it absorbs moisture well, its production can be harmful to the environment.
  • Clumping Clay: Similar to bentonite, this type is also non-biodegradable, making it a less eco-friendly option.

2. Biodegradable Litter Options

  • Wood-Based Litter: Made from sawdust and wood shavings, this option breaks down naturally and is often compostable.
  • Corn-Based Litter: Derived from corn kernels, this litter is biodegradable and packed with clumping capabilities.
  • Wheat-Based Litter: Another plant-based option that decomposes quickly and can be composted.
  • Paper-Based Litter: Produced from recycled paper, it’s absorbent and biodegradable.

Is Cat Litter Biodegradable?

The answer largely depends on the type of litter used. If you choose a wood, corn, wheat, or paper-based option, then yes, cat litter is biodegradable. However, conventional clay litters are not biodegradable and can contribute significantly to landfill waste.

Benefits of Biodegradable Cat Litter

  • Eco-friendly: Reduces landfill waste and promotes sustainability.
  • Compostable: Many biodegradable litters can be composted under the right conditions.
  • Less Dust and Chemicals: Often, these litters are less dusty and free from harmful additives that can affect your pet’s health.

Common Concerns about Biodegradable Cat Litter

Here are some common issues pet owners face when switching to biodegradable cat litter and practical solutions to address them:

1. Odor Control

Solution: Look for brands that use natural ingredients or additives such as baking soda for effective odor control.

2. Clumping Ability

Solution: Seek out biodegradable litters that specifically state they have superior clumping capabilities. Corn and wheat-based litters often perform well in this area.

3. Cost

Solution: Understand that while biodegradable options might be more expensive initially, they can be more economical in the long run due to their compostable nature.

4. Availability

Solution: If your local pet store doesn’t carry biodegradable options, check online retailers or consider local farm supply stores that may offer more eco-friendly choices.
